Funding approved for Tipperary Racecourse.

The board of Horse Racing Ireland has approved a funding allocation of €280,000 for further works at Tipperary Racecourse.

The money will go towards the €375,000 refurbishment of the Tipperary Stand.
In total €700,000 will eventually be spent on redeveloping parts of Tipperary Racecourse.
Welcoming the allocation of funding, Tipperary Racecourse Manager Andrew Hogan said that while the upgrade and extension of the stand won’t be completed until 2019, initial work will be carried out immediately to remodel the toilets and upgrade the second bar area.
Work will also get underway to improve facilities for racegoers, trainers, jockeys and ambulance staff.
